About Our Company

Big Ass Fan Company is the preeminent designer and manufacturer of 6 ft. to 24′ diameter high volume/low speed (HVLS) ceiling and vertical fans developed to provide significant energy savings and improve occupant comfort year round in large commercial, industrial, agricultural, institutional and residential buildings. In the U.S., we are based in Lexington, KY and occupy a 100,000 sq. ft. manufacturing facility, a 33,000 sq. ft. administrative office, and a LEED Gold Certified, 44,000 sq. ft. R&D facility. Our 10,000 sq. ft. (1000 m2) Australian facility is located in Tingalpa, Queensland and houses our administrative office, Sales, Marketing, Applications Engineering and warehouse.

Big Ass Fans has over 65,000 fans in operation in hundreds of different applications all over the world. Our dedicated team of engineers rigorously designs and tests every fan we build to ensure they are the most effective and reliable fans possible.

Our R&D facility enables us to develop fans such as our Powerfoil X2.0 for the industrial market, a fan that sets the standard for air circulation, safety, and durability. For the commercial and institutional markets, our Element and Isis fans use cutting-edge motor technology to merge space-age design with silent operation, allowing our customers to use them in applications as varied as schools, health clubs, auditoriums, and churches.

How Did You Come Up with That Name Big Ass Fans?

We started in 1999 as the HVLS Fan Company, but after 3 years in business we finally had to bow to the sentiments of our customers and concede that we do, in fact, design and manufacture some Big Ass Fans. It was therefore a natural step to change our name to Big Ass Fan Company, and to “adopt” our mascot, Fanny the Donkey, shortly thereafter.
